    Shepard Smith. David Shepard Smith Jr. (born January 14, 1964) [1] is a former American broadcast journalist. He served as chief general news anchor and host of The News with Shepard Smith on CNBC, a daily evening newscast launched in late September 2020; [2] but his program was canceled in November 2022.

    Fox News presents a variety of programming with up to 20 hours of live programming per day. Most of the programs are broadcast from Fox News headquarters in New York City in their street-side studio on Sixth Avenue in the west extension of Rockefeller Center. The network's other programs are broadcast from Fox News' studio in Washington, D.C., located on Capitol Hill across from Union Station ...

    Trace Gallagher (2022—present): Host of Fox News @ Night W/Trace Gallagher. Gallagher, who has been with Fox since its inception, serves as Fox News' Chief Breaking News correspondent. He was named permanent host of the program in September 2022 following the departure of founding host Shannon Bream when she was named anchor of Fox News Sunday.
